Rats found in Tesco delivery crate and in restaurant

Beckie Richardson, 19, from Essex, started hyperventilating and collapsed when she found a live rat inside a crate containing her online shopping order from Tesco, according to her mother Sue Richardson.
Mrs Richardson, who was also unloading the crates and rushed to help her daughter, told ITV News: “As Beckie lifted one of [the crates] I heard an almighty crash and she was on the floor.
“I looked in the crate and this rat was just there looking up at us sitting next to the Smarties, eggs, and tins.
“My daughter was so traumatised by it that she had a panic attack and fell on the floor and rather than getting away from the rat, I had to look after her.”
A Tesco spokesman said: “We take the cleanliness of our stores and delivery vehicles extremely seriously so were concerned to hear of the issue at our Romford Gallows Corner store.
“Although we’re confident this is an isolated incident, we’ve taken immediate action including working with a pest-control company and jet washing the area where we store our online deliveries.
“We have visited and apologised to Mrs Richardson, delivered a replacement tray of groceries, and offered her some flowers as a gesture of goodwill.”
